Thursday, October 02, 2008 (DOT 146-08)

Statement from U.S. Transportation Secretary Mary E. Peters on Rail Legislation

 

“This legislation takes positive steps to further improve rail safety in the U.S.

“We remain committed to working with Congress to implement meaningful changes to improve the performance of our intercity passenger rail system. Our passenger rail system should be driven by sound economics, competition, and improved management of the Northeast Corridor. Future reforms should benefit consumers and protect taxpayers.

“Given the improvements to rail safety, the President is expected to sign the bill.”
